Creative, innovative visualizations
- [Instructor] Sometimes a bar chart or a line chart or another out-of-the-box named typical chart just won't express the data the way you need to express it. In those cases, you might try something different. For instance, I created a data story focused on whether you can compete and win in the Olympics once you turn 50 years old. The opening examines the distribution of athletes by age. I could have used a standard histogram here, but to keep things a bit fresh, and visually interesting, I just vertically centered the histogram. You could argue it makes it harder to accurately compare the values, and you'd probably be right, but my goal with this visual is for you to just see how few older athletes there are, not make a precise comparison.
